      <description>The Kursk costume was distinguished by its colorfulness and abundance of decorative ornaments. All the details were combined and created a single image. The unifying principle was the dark color of the sundress, which gives integrity and expressiveness.</description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>Women wore a shirt, skirt and apron. Sundresses were sewn from thin black wool homemade fabric. The bodice of such a sundress was decorated with embroidery&nbsp; with wool colored threads, sequins, and various colored pieces of satin, brocade, cashmere — the bodice and bottom.<br>Women's shirts were often made with sleeves longer than the arms and ended with long narrow cuffs. Sometimes the wide sleeves at the bottom were assembled into frequent assemblies, stuck with cuffs.<br><br></div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>Men wore tunic – like kosovorotki with a stand-up collar made of dense factory fabric.<br>The costume is colorful, and the abundance of color and various decorative solutions does not break up a single image.<br><br></div>]]></description>

         <description><![CDATA[<div>Festive clothes were always newer, they were made of expensive fabric, made up of a larger number of items, heavily decorated. A variety of ceremonial costumes are attached directly to the clothes: a betrothed girl, a wedding, a funeral. This also includes clothing complexes that were worn during the spring very ancient pre-Christian holidays associated with pagan worship. <br><br></div>]]></description>
